The agreement covers delivery of directional drilling, measurement-while-drilling, logging-while-drilling and mud logging services.

The contract, which becomes effective on September 1, 2008, has a value of NOK900 million and is for a duration of two years. The contract also has two optional extensions, each for two years.

Oystein Haland, senior vice president for sub-surface technology, technology & new energy, said: The contract secures supply of services and competent personnel which ensures cost efficient operations through focus on the quality of tools and services. The contract also contributes to the development of StatoilHydro’s focus area, integrated operations, with the aim of improving safety and drilling efficiency.
